| Hello, Firstly apologies as I know staking questions arent so popular but I am hoping some more mathematically minded people might be able to help out. I am aware of he strategies but unsure on how to work out the best to use? Eg. Person A bets mainly 1.91 Lines, Person B mainly bets outsiders, Person C bets short prices, Person D bets all of the above depending on where there is value. Which plan is best suited to each? I am reading a lot on Kelly, more specifically half kelly or quarter kelly at the moment but not sure whether fixed stake, fixed % are just as useful. I am well aware that without being a success at fixed stake, no staking plan will improve. One final question. If I feel I have an edge on a game - say the market is 2.06 draw no bet and I feel they should be favourite, is there benefit to staking the asian handicap as well as the coupon or sticking to one market? Obviously the coupon odds will be far superior to he handicap but the team will need to win. |

| The popular money management recommendation to bet 2% of starting bank I believe is with Person A in mind. Certainly, depending on Person B's average outsider price, they could/would be wise to adjust their stakes to smaller amounts. Likewise Person C may as well stake higher than 2%, since less likelihood of a long losing streak. I'm a Person D, however my average price is somewhat greater than 2.00 and I've always found I don't have major losing streaks (touch wood), so I'm happy staking 2%. Whether it's 1.50 or 5.00 I still like to stake the same amount (never waste value!), although bigger odds I may taper the stake a little. I actually hate hearing people tip a 3.50 outsider then make the comment "small stake, of coarse" as if that's some sort of smart thinking - I've actually formed the opinion that although many punters like to buzzword "value" most only make sense out of thinking winners, which I think is pi$$ weak and effecting their performance. I've always done it based on starting bank but as a way of raising stakes I'm considering changing my plan to 3% of available bank. |
